Absolutely everything left over from Christmas Dinner and I do mean everything except puddings. In the frying pan with half a pound of Lurpak. Fried till hot, fast baked for 10 minutes to create a crust, good sprinkle of grated Stilton.
Served with ketchup and crusty bread.
The ultimate bubble n squeak. Delicious.
